Abstract

Dengue hemorrhagic fever (DHF) is still a health problem in Indonesia. This study aims to determine the vector entomology index of Aedes spp mosquitoes in dengue endemic areas in the East Tanjungpinang District, Tanjungpinang City. The study was conducted in January-March 2020 with a cross sectional method. The research locations in DHF endemic areas are Batu 9 and Bulang villages. Entomological data were analyzed descriptively. The results showed that the value of the House index for Batu 9 was 45% and Kampung Bulang was 38.8%. The Containteir index value is 12.6% in Batu 9 and Kampung Bulang. The Breteau index value in Kelurahan Batu 9 was 76% and Kampung Bulang was 68%, while the Larva free rate in Batu 9 was 55% and 61% in Kampung Bulang Village. Density of dengue vector larvae based on HI, CI and BI in both DHF endemic villages is on a scale of 4-7 and is included in the medium and high risk categories. This explains that the entomological index in East Tanjungpinang District is still low, so it is necessary to control Aedes spp larvae by draining the bath, closing water storage, conducting mosquito nest eradication, and burying used goods so that they do not become a breeding place for DHF vectors.

Abstract

Dengue hemorrhagic fever (DHF) is a disease that is still a health problem in Indonesia caused by the dengue virus and is transmitted through the Aedes spp mosquito as the main vector that causes this disease. Tanjungpinang Timur District since January-December 2020 in the Pinang Kencana Village has recorded 52 positive right. The type and design of this study used observational research by conducting a descriptive analysis survey with a cross sectional study approach, the variables studied were the entomological index and the distribution of the Aedes spp mosquito vector. How to collect data by surveying larvae and taking the coordinates of the houses of DHF sufferers and their surrounding houses. The results of this study show that as many as 100 houses were surveyed, the House Index (HI) was 28%, the Container Index (CI) was 14% and the Breteau Index (BI) was 33%. The distribution of the presence of Aedes spp mosquito larvae is based on the coordinates of the house of dengue cases adjacent to the positive house of Aedes spp mosquito larvae in Pinang Kencana Village, Tanjungpinang Timur District. The conclusion of this study, based on the results of the entomological index, obtained a Density Figure (DF) in Pinang Kencana Village with a medium density category. Suggestions for the community to more attention cleanliness of controllable containers. Containers are most found larvae is bucket containers  inside house and bottle containers outside house. Suggestions for health agencies can be a reference in vector control and can further mobilize Mosquito Nest Eradication (MNE) and 3M Plus in Pinang Kencana Village, Tanjungpinang Timur District.

Abstract

Tiban Baru area is one of the endemic areas of Dengue Fever (DHF) in Batam City. Previous studies have reported nocturnal blood-sucking activities of Aedes spp mosquitoes in several regions in Indonesia. The behavioral change of the blood-sucking activity of Aedes spp mosquitoes may impact the transmission of dengue fever. The study aimed to determine the activity of Aedes spp, a vector of DHF in the Tiban Baru area, Batam City. The research was descriptive with a cross-sectional design. This study was conducted in 25 houses, with mosquito collection in the field using the resting mosquito collection method starting from 6:00 pm to 6:00 am.  Measurement of environmental parameters including temperature and humidity in the environment around the study.  The results stated that there was a change in the blood-sucking activity of Aedes spp mosquitoes from 16.00 to 17.00 to 18.00 to 21.00. The distribution of Aedes albopictus mosquitoes in the Tiban Baru area was 89.4% of the total Aedes spp mosquitoes collected with a Man Bitting Rate (MBR) value of 56.6%. The average temperature and humidity in the Tiban Baru area were 280C and 75%. Changes in the blood-sucking activity of Aedes spp mosquitoes can increase the risk of dengue transmission so efforts are needed for the prevention and control of dengue vectors in the study area.

Abstract

The role of a healthy home and the environment has a significant influence on individual health. Tanjungpinang City is an archipelago area where most of the population lives on the coast. The component of healthy house sanitation is strongly related to the incidence of diarrheal diseases. In 2023, the incidence of diarrhea in Tanjungpinang City was 2273 cases. This research was carried out in an observational, descriptive, and analytical manner, with a cross-sectional research design; the sample in this study consisted of 100 houses of residents living in the coastal area of Tanjungpinang City. The analysis of this study was in the form of a Chi-Square analysis, namely the relationship between the components of healthy home sanitation (clean water facilities, healthy latrine facilities, wastewater disposal facilities, waste management facilities, food and beverage management, and the application of hand washing with soap) and the incidence of diarrhea. This study showed that the management of food and beverages was related to the incidence of diarrhea, and the application of hand washing with soap was related to the incidence of diarrhea. This study concludes that there was a relationship between food and beverage management, the application of hand washing with soap, and the incidence of diarrhea. This research is expected to play an important role and be urgent in developing information and usefulness in solving the problem of healthy homes and control of diarrheal diseases in the coastal areas of Tanjungpinang City, Riau Islands Province.

Abstract

Demam Berdarah Dengue salah satu masalah kesehatan di Indonesia yang cenderung selalu mengalami peningkatan jumlah kejadiannya dengan penyebaran semakin luas sejalan dengan meningkatnya mobilitas dan kepadatan penduduk. Tujuan penelitian ini untuk mengetahui efektivitas temephos terhadap pengendalian demam berdarah dengue di RT.01 RW.11 Kelurahan Pinang Kencana Kecamatan Tanjungpinang Timur tahun 2023. Jenis penelitian yaitu eksperimen dengan desain penelitian Post test only control group design, yang menjadi populasi dalam penelitian ini seluruh telur nyamuk Aedes sp yang di dapatkan dirumah penderita DBD dan rumah di sekitarnya, sampel nya larva Aedes sp dari telur yang didapatkan dengan menggunakan ovitrap, telur yang dapat di keringkan terlebih dahulu sebelum di kembangbiakkan hingga menjadi larva instar III. Hasil dari penelitian jumlah sampel mati pada perlakuan pertama yang diamati setelah pemberian temephos dengan 5 konsentrasi menunjukkan hasil yang bervariasi. Kematian di empat jam pertama tertinggi konsentrasi 2mg sebanyak 12 larva Aedes sp mengalami kematian serta pengulangan kedua larva Aedes sp tertinggi pada kosentrasi 10 mg dengan jumlah kematian larva sebanyak 19. Kesimpulan efektivitas temephos terhadap kematian larva nyamuk Aedes sp di Kelurahan Pinang Kencana berada pada kategori rentan dengan penggunaan temephos 1% sehingga temephos masih efektif untuk membunuh larva Aedes sp pada kosentrasi 8mg dan 10mg efektif kematian pada larva sebesar 100%. Sarannya masyarakat harus rajin melakukan kegiatan 3M seperti menguras bak air dengan menambahkan temephos, menutup tempat yang dapat menyebabkan potensi berkembangbiak dan mengubur barang bekas yang dapat menampung air.

Abstract

Demam Berdarah Dengue (DBD) merupakan penyakit menular yang masih menjadi masalah kesehatan masyarakat di Indonesia, termasuk di Kelurahan Pinang Kencana, Kota Tanjungpinang. Penelitian ini bertujuan untuk mengetahui kondisi fisik rumah, khususnya pencahayaan, suhu, dan kelembaban, terhadap kejadian DBD. Populasi dalam penelitian ini adalah Seluruh rumah di Perumahan Bumi Air Raja RT 002 RW 003  sebanyak 400 rumah. sampel sebanyak 80 rumah. Teknik pengambilan sampel menggunakan probability sampling. Data dikumpulkan melalui observasi dan pengukuran fisik lingkungan rumah.  Hasil penelitian menunjukkan bahwa (12,5%) rumah tangga mengalami kejadian DBD. Sebanyak (80%) rumah penderita memiliki suhu dan kelembaban yang tidak memenuhi standar, serta (40%) rumah memiliki pencahayaan yang kurang. Kondisi fisik lingkungan rumah yang tidak sesuai standar tersebut berpotensi mendukung perkembangbiakan nyamuk Aedes aegypti dan memperbesar risiko penyebaran DBD. Oleh karena itu, perbaikan kondisi pencahayaan, suhu, dan kelembaban rumah sangat diperlukan sebagai langkah preventif dalam pengendalian DBD di wilayah tersebut.

Abstract

Kejadian Demam Berdarah Dengue di Kota Tanjungpinang terjadi 346 kasus pada tahun 2019. Kasus  DBD yang masih cukup tinggi menunjukkan bahwa upaya pengendalian dan pemberantasan  vektor DBD masil  belum optimal. Setiap penduduk yang tinggal di wilayah ini berisiko tertular DBD. Maya index  dapat menganalisa risiko penularan DBD dan tempat perkembangbiakan potensial Aedes Aegypti  di suatu wilayah. Tujuan dari penelitian ini yaitu menggambarkan Maya Index dan container pada rumah tangga di wilayah Kelurahan Batu 9 Kota Tanjungpinang. Metode penelitian ini observasional analitik dengan pendekatan cross sectional. Populasi dalam penelitian ini adalah semua rumah warga yang terdapat di Kelurahan Batu 9. Sampel penelitian terdiri dari 100 rumah. Pengambilan sampel menggunakan metode purposive sampling. Analisis Maya Index menggunakan Breeding Risk Index dan  Hygiene Risk Index.  Jumlah container yang di observasi yaitu sebanyak 383 buah di Kelurahan Batu 9. Container  yang  berpotensi menjadi tempat  perkembangbiakan nyamuk yaitu container ember dan dispenser. Status Maya Index dikategorikan kepada kategori tinggi yang ditentukan berdasarkan kategori Breeding Risk Index dan Hygiene risk index. Berdasarkan Maya Index menunjukkan Kelurahan Batu 9 memili risiko yang tinggi terhadap penularan DBD dan juga   sebagai tempat perkembangbiakan nyamuk. Masyarakat di Kelurahan Batu 9 diharapkan melakukan pemberantasan sarang nyamuk dan  program 4M plus dengan menguras  penampungan air, mengubur barang bekas, menutup tempat penampungan air dan memantau larva secara rutin.
